Madhay Pradesh : The Numero Uno state for Wildlife Tourism in India

Finally, good news rolling out of the forests of Madhya Pradesh. As per the latest reports of Wildlife Institute of India ( WII, Dehradun ), The number of tigers in Madhya Pradesh might increase from the existing 308 (as per 2014 census by NTCA ) to 415. This report is an amalgamation of camera trappings, pugmarks & scientific reports.

It is speculated that WII might release the report in the coming fortnight.

NTCA ( National tiger Conservation Authority ) has conducted a state wise counting of tigers in Madhya Pradesh from Dec ‘2017 to April ‘2018 in the national parks, wildlife sanctuaries and unreserved forests of Madhya Pradesh. This counting, done every four years was conducted last in 2014 and had reported 308 tigers n Madhya Pradesh. Authorities closely associated with this are extremely optimistic of a final figure crossing 415 tigers in Madhya Pradesh.

The analysis of the “Tiger Census 2018” concludes significant increase in the number of resident tigers in the unreserved forests too. Even the territorial areas of the tigers has enhanced in the Jabalpur forest circle.

The State Forest Research Institute, Jabalpur has forwarded all the primary survey and trap camera records to National Tiger Conservation Authorities & Wildlife Institute of India. They will be processing the same and analysis of a PAN India state wise records will be submitted finally.

Around 4,600 trap cameras and forest department employees were used for this tiger count.

The year 2014 recorded tiger presence in 717 beats of Madhya Pradesh. The current consus projects tiger presence in 1432 beats. In 2014, Kanha National park recorded tiger presence in 155 beats of 11 11 ranges. The current census shows a positive tiger presence in 188 beats in 13 ranges.

Currently, Kanha National Park has 83 tigers and Bandhavgarh National Park has 61 tigers.

Similarly, in Jabalpur circle, the presence of tigers has enhanced from 28 to 62 beats.

The tiger census of 2014 declared Karnataka having a count of 408 tigers, Uttarakhand with 340 & Madhya Pradesh ranked No 3 with 308 tigers.

Year Wise Tiger Census of  Madhya Pradesh

2006 – 300 tigers

2010 – 257 tigers

2014 – 308 tigers

Madhya Pradesh had received the “Tiger State” award in 1991 when the total count of tigers were said to be 900, which included the state of Chattisgarh too.

Madhya Pradesh lost this coveted title to Karnataka in 2010.

The government of Madhya Pradesh is planning to declare newer National Parks and Wildlife sanctuaries to protect the species. Omkareshwar National Park, Mandhata, Singhaji and Ratapani wildlife Sanctuaries has already been shortlisted.

Kanha National Park has been an inspiration for Rudyard Kipling’s ‘Jungle Book’ and there are plenty of reasons for it. Located in the state of Madhya Pradesh, this park is popularly noted for its collection of tigers. Needless to say, the beauty of Kanha National Park is stupefying and it has been so from the time it was formed. Created in 1955, this park has been an ideal home for both prey and predator. The park had come into existence with the sole motive of protecting the tigers and combatting the chances of its extinction. It is also known to be one of the most beautiful wildlife reserves in the whole of Asia.

The tigers in this park are majestic and royal in the truest sense. With respect to this, how many of you been in close proximity with tigers? Arguably, nearly everyone will agree that we have seen tigers only in enclosed areas in the zoos and circuses! Imagine how would you feel when you suddenly see tigers moving around freely in the whole park?

With so many tigers inhabiting this park, there are a few of them who are more special than the others. They are also named just like domestic animals to give out a sense of homeliness. Read on to know more about some of the popular tigers of Kanha National Park:

1. Neelam- The main attraction of this park is Neelam(tigress) and her four male cubs. The strong emotional connection between a mother and her children is evidently discerned from their bonding so much so that when one of the cubs got injured from a fight with another tiger, Neelam did all that she could to save her child. The forest department then provided the necessary care to both the mother and the child.

2. Munna- He is the oldest tiger of this park and is the most popular one. This tiger is famously recognized with the letters C-A-T spelled on its forehead from the formation of black stripes. Moreover, you will be surprised to know that Munna is quite comfortable interacting with humans! He is now accustomed to having jeeps and humans entering his area. He is the most adorable creature that you will ever come across in this park since he behaves just like your pet! He is the most entertaining tiger of this park. Initially in the previous years, at the beginning he was quite infamous for attacking the locals of the place; his reputation was very much different from his present one so much so that he killed other tigers and also ate their cubs. The fact that he is the ‘star’ of Kanha National Park is because of his daunting valor and ability to fight others.

3. Bheema- Another famous tiger of this park, Bheema, is also known as ‘the peaceful warrior’. He was born to Kankata, his father and Budbudi, his mother and has three other siblings. Mainly sighted in the Mukki and Kisli zones, he was given the title ‘peaceful warrior’ for a reason: he bore his injury marks with the pride of a warrior. Unfortunately, Bheema gave up his life after battling with the leg injuries that he received from a fight with another tiger of this park named Munna.

Conclusion- Other than these, you can also sight several other equally popular tigers of Kanha National Park and some of their names are Nak-Kata, Mahavir (there are two Mahavirs, male and female) and Red Eye. Kanha National Park: the largest and the best National Park

“Jungle Book’ by Rudyard Kipling is totally inspired by Kanha & Pench National Park, the largest national parks in the entire state. Kanha National Park features lush greenery, beautiful ravines and tiny hamlets. The site is popular among the wildlife enthusiasts. This national park is an epitome of successful wildlife conservation of Barasingha or Hard Ground Swamp Deer that speaks about the immense dedication of local population and forest department. Catch the glimpse of sprawling tigers, blackbuck, chital, bison, woodpeckers, Spur Fowl, Jungle Cats, Hyenas and others. To optimize your experience, check out MP Tourism operated Baghira Jungle Resort, Kanha Safari Lodge and Gawa Kanha Resort.

Bandhavgarh National Park: the national park of mythological importance

The Bandhavgarh National Park is a beautiful forest known for abundance in vegetation and wildlife. The Bandhavgarh Fort is of tremendous importance and is thought to have been gifted by Lord Rama to his brother Laxmana. Dating back to some 2000 years ago, ‘Bandhav’ means ‘brother’ and ‘Garh’ means ‘Fort’. It has the highest number of Royal Bengal Tigers. The very sight of a wild and majestic tiger will fill you with awe.

While at Bandhavgarh, stay at MP Tourism operated White Tiger Forest Lodge

The Pench National Park derives its name from Pench River flowing through the forest won the ‘Best Management Award’ in the year 2011. In the Ain-i-Akbari, there is the description of this park and so it is being immortalized. You can find Sambhar and Chital in plenty here. More than 1000 species of plants can be located here.

While at Pench, stay at MP Tourism operated Kipling Court in Madhya Pradesh

Situated in the Panna district, visit Panna National Park during January and May to experience the best. The entire forest is lush green during the monsoons. There are popular mines here that shine with diamonds. Popular for waterfalls and some of the largest predators, Panna National Park can thrill you, excite you and even calm you totally. Spot majestic tigers and ‘Ghariyal’ here.

Satpura National Park

Deriving its name from Satpura Range, the national park in Madhya Pradesh covers 524 square kilometres. Satpura Tiger Reserve is popular for boat safari, elephant ride, Jungle Safari and night safaris. It is known for complete tranquility, absolute wilderness and the air of mysticism. Craving a slice of history? Or is a long planned pilgrimage on your mind? Sanchi, one of the most famous places that coloured the history of ancient India, should prove to be the place for you. Steeped in history, knowledge and a surreal vibe that echoes the past, Sanchi is still revered.
Tourists from all over the world make their way to Madhya Pradesh not just to enjoy thrilling rides cruising through the dense forests and national parks getting glimpses of the majestic Royal Bengal Tigers and the exotic fauna it offers but Sanchi is also among one of the main attractions. Sanchi was also the seat where Buddhism flourished and consequently met with a setback in the early centuries as a result of various conquests. Declared by UNESCO in the year 1989, Sanchi garnered a place in the list of World Heritage Sites and continues to be the pull for travel enthusiasts, archaeologists and pilgrims alike.
Planning a trip to Madhya Pradesh needs your precious time as there is no dearth of places to visit in this wondrous state. Do you have Sanchi on your travel itinerary? Let us present some of the most exciting places that you can visit in Sanchi while you are touring the neighbourhood.

Sanchi Stupas
Sanchi is synonymous with the word Stupas. These architectural mammoths created during the 3rd century B.C under the reign of Ashoka, are a sight to behold. The Great Stupa, one of the oldest among them is carved with magnificent etchings that never fail to instil within the viewer a sense of awe. Standing tall at 71 feet, the Great Stupa surely towers over all the other touristy sites and overshadows everything in its vicinity. Explore every nook and corner of this great architectural masterpiece or simply stand afar and admire. Disappointment would be the last thing to cross your mind.

Sanchi Museum
Not close behind is the Sanchi Museum, that houses a plethora of exotic objects from the long forgotten past. A popular site for the history buffs, going through the artefacts and relics are sure to take you centuries back. The royal dynasties that were the supreme power of the land, their conquests and the lavish manner in which they spent their days seem to transcend through the numerous relics, leaving visitors with an open mouthed wonder.
There surely is something uncanny about seals and paintings that are products of a rich history. Visit the museum reverberating with history and come back armed with numerous tales of the bygone times.

Gupta Temple
Built in the 5th Century AD by the royal dynasties of the Guptas, this architectural wonder continues to inspire builders all over the globe. The Gupta Temple has been designed to form one of the most mathematically approved structures. The temple indeed makes one feel in awe of the brilliant engineering methods followed by the builders of the past who successfully attempted to make such an imposing monument without having in possession any of the modern equipments that we now take for granted. Sanchi is predominantly a Buddhist pilgrimage centre yet the Gupta Temple catered to people belonging to different religions.
The temple is almost in ruins now but the superior craftsmanship cannot be mistaken.

Ashoka Pillar
A stalwart in the history of architectural creations, the Ashoka Pillar situated south of the Great Stupa is one of the many pillars built by the Emperor during his reign. Ashoka was known to strive for an end to the violence that was a result of warring countries and erected these pillars that were etched with his edicts. The pillar at Sanchi stands at a might height of 50 feet, reflecting the majestic rule during the bygone era and stands as a true representation of one of the most revered Emperors.

Udaygiri Caves
A series of twenty caves, these caves attract thousands from afar due to the sheer beauty that the carvings inside generate. Depicting sculptures and deities belonging to Jainism and Hinduism from the Gupta period(4th century AD), the caves offer a pinpointed glimpse into the past. The caves can be found on the top as well as on the foothills and never fail to inspire with their brilliantly intricate carvings that successfully convey stories of a violent and glorious past.
